The university provides digital identities for all enrolled individuals, facilitating access to a wide array of institutional services. These digital profiles enable authentication for systems critical to academic and administrative functions. For example, a student utilizes these credentials to log into learning management systems, university email, and secure campus Wi-Fi.
Secure access to these services is vital for successful participation in university life. It streamlines academic workflows, simplifies communication with faculty and staff, and provides a secure platform for managing financial aid and tuition payments. This system has evolved alongside technological advancements, becoming increasingly integral to the student experience and ensuring data security.
